BACON CHEDDAR CORNMEAL MUFFINS
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 425°. Cook bacon in a large skillet over medium-high heat 12 to 14 minutes or until crisp; remove bacon, and drain on paper towels. Crumble bacon. Heat a 12-cup muffin pan in oven 5 minutes. Combine cornmeal mix and sugar in a medium bowl; make a well in center of mixture. Stir together buttermilk and egg; add to cornmeal mixture, stirring just until dry ingredients are moistened. Stir in melted butter, cheese, and bacon. Remove pan from oven, and coat with cooking spray. Spoon batter into hot muffin pan, filling almost completely full. Bake at 425° for 15 to 20 minutes or until golden. Remove from pan to a wire rack, and let cool 10 minutes.
BACON CORNMEAL MUFFINS
These muffins are yummy for breakfast right out of the oven or along with any meal.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400F. Grease or paper line a muffin pan. Fry the bacon in skillet or on cookie sheet in oven until crisp. Drain on paper towls, Then chop into small pieces. Set aside. Melt the butter and margarine in a saucepan over low heat and set aside.
- Sift the flour, baking powder, sugar and salt into a large mixing bowl. Stir in the cornmeal, then make a well in the center. In another saucepan, heat the milk to lukewarm. In a small bowl lightly beat the eggs, then add to the milk. Stir in the melted fats.
- Pour the milk mixture into the center of the well and stir until smooth and well blended. Fold in the bacon. Spoon the batter into the prepared pans, filling them halfway. Bake for about 20 minutes, until and lightl colored.
